What are Artificial Coral Reefs?
Artificial coral reefs are man-made structures designed to mimic the natural coral reefs. They are constructed using various materials such as concrete, steel, and recycled plastics. These structures provide a substrate for corals to attach and grow, thereby creating a new habitat for marine life. The concept of artificial coral reefs has gained significant attention in recent years as a means to restore and protect the declining natural coral reefs.
Benefits of Artificial Coral Reefs
Artificial coral reefs offer numerous benefits to marine ecosystems and human communities. Here are some of the key advantages:
-
Providing Habitat: Artificial coral reefs create new habitats for marine species, including fish, invertebrates, and even marine mammals. This helps in maintaining the biodiversity of the marine ecosystem.
-
Restoring Natural Coral Reefs: By providing a substrate for corals to grow, artificial coral reefs can help restore damaged natural coral reefs. This is particularly important in areas where natural coral reefs have been destroyed due to human activities.
-
Enhancing Fish Stocks: Artificial coral reefs can attract fish and other marine species, leading to an increase in fish stocks. This has a positive impact on local fisheries and can provide food and income for communities living near the reefs.
-
Protecting Coastlines: Artificial coral reefs can act as a natural barrier against coastal erosion, protecting coastal communities from the impacts of storms and waves.
-
Education and Research: Artificial coral reefs provide opportunities for education and research, helping us better understand marine ecosystems and the challenges they face.
Challenges in Creating Artificial Coral Reefs
While artificial coral reefs offer numerous benefits, there are several challenges associated with their creation and maintenance:
-
Material Selection: Choosing the right material for constructing artificial coral reefs is crucial. The material should be durable, non-toxic, and able to support coral growth. Some materials, such as concrete, can be harmful to marine life if not properly treated.
-
Design and Placement: The design and placement of artificial coral reefs are critical for their success. The structures should be strategically positioned to maximize their benefits while minimizing negative impacts on the environment.
-
Cost and Maintenance: Constructing and maintaining artificial coral reefs can be expensive. Regular monitoring and maintenance are required to ensure their long-term success.
-
Public Perception: Some people may have concerns about the environmental impact of artificial coral reefs. Addressing these concerns and educating the public about the benefits of these structures is essential.
Latest Advancements in Artificial Coral Reefs
Over the years, researchers and engineers have made significant advancements in the field of artificial coral reefs. Here are some of the latest developments:
-
Biodegradable Materials: Researchers are exploring the use of biodegradable materials, such as bamboo and seashells, for constructing artificial coral reefs. These materials are environmentally friendly and can be broken down over time, leaving no long-term impact on the marine ecosystem.
-
3D Printing: 3D printing technology is being used to create intricate and customized artificial coral reefs. This allows for the creation of structures that closely resemble natural coral reefs, providing a more suitable habitat for marine life.
-
Genetically Engineered Corals: Some researchers are exploring the use of genetically engineered corals to enhance their resilience to climate change and other stressors. This could help in creating more robust artificial coral reefs.
